What immediate impacts resulted from the repeated communication breakdowns at Newark Liberty International Airport?
Last week's communications breakdown at Newark Liberty International Airport, where air traffic controllers lost contact with planes for up to 90 seconds, has reportedly occurred at least 11 times since August. This resulted in significant flight delays and cancellations, with United Airlines canceling 35 daily roundtrip flights. Four experienced controllers and a trainee are on stress leave, highlighting staffing shortages.
What systemic factors contributed to the multiple communication failures at Newark Airport, and what are their broader implications?
The incident reveals a broader pattern of systemic issues within the nation's air traffic control system. Chronic understaffing, outdated technology, and decades of underinvestment have created a fragile system, leading to multiple communication failures at a major airport. The resulting delays and cancellations demonstrate the significant impact of these failures on air travel.
What long-term solutions are necessary to prevent future occurrences of this nature, considering the current staffing shortages and technological limitations?
The Newark airport incident underscores the urgent need for comprehensive reform within the FAA. Addressing the 3,000 vacant controller positions nationwide and upgrading outdated technology are crucial for preventing future near-misses. The long training period for new controllers (1.5 years) necessitates immediate and innovative solutions to attract and retain talent.
